Here's how the system works: Master Duel has a currency used for crafting called CP Each rarity has its own CP type You can't convert one type of CP into another When Dismantled, each card will generate the following amounts of CP: 10 CP if the card has a Basic Finish (no foil) 15 CP if the card has a Glossy Finish 30 CP if the card has a Royal Finish Each card requires 30 CP of it's respective rarity to craft There's a chance the card will be crafted with a Glossy or Royal Finish, but you have no control over that In short, Master Duel uses a 3 to 1 crafting ratio for its cards (you normally need to Dismantle 3 cards of a certain rarity in order to make 1 card of that rarity), but you can't Dismantle multiple cards of a lower rarity to make a card of a greater rarity
